Notes for Virtual Switches, Page Three
1. The Expansion port on the rear of the Alpha-Link can be used to perform firmware upgrades. The Alpha-Link LIVE
unit runs different firmware to the other units in the Alpha-Link range but the Expansion port is unable to detect
this difference. Therefore, to guard against accidental and incorrect firmware updates, the Alpha-Link LIVE will by
default not accept firmware updates over the Expansion port. At the time of writing, firmware update is not
possible over the MADI port.
2. When
EXT
is selected as the clock source and ‘MADI or Video’ has been selected in virtual switches page two,
setting switches 5 through 8 to ‘off’ will enable the clock signal embedded in the incoming MADI stream to be
used as the clock source.
3. When
EXT
is selected as the clock source and ‘MADI or Video’ has been selected in virtual switches page two,
these virtual switches allow Alpha-Link to lock to an applied NTSC/colour (29.97Hz) video sync signal. Because
the video sync signal obviously carries no sample rate information, it will be necessary to select the required
sample rate using the appropriate switches.
4. When
EXT
is selected as the clock source and ‘MADI or Video’ has been selected in virtual switches page two,
these virtual switches allow Alpha-Link to lock to an applied PAL video sync signal. Because the video sync signal
obviously carries no sample rate information, it will be necessary to select the required sample rate using the
appropriate switches.
